(PR Web Via Acquire Media NewsEdge) MINNEAPOLIS – Sept 30, 2014 (PRWEB) September 30, 2014 -- The CMO Council reports that "[M]arketers say their biggest problem is a lack of reliable metrics to define success and failure in a multichannel online environment." Presenza, from WPO Inc, is the first strategic online competitive and marketing performance measurement software that introduces webshare as a key performance indicator (KPI) for online marketers. Analogous to market share, this KPI will prove to become one of a small basket of strategic metrics for defining and measuring online marketing success.



"We're in the early stages of rolling out our multichannel Scoreboard platform for measuring your webshare for converged media and competitor performance trends," said Kirsten Chapman, the company's CEO. "The first product we're releasing is our Press module, which will be closely followed by the Social and Website modules. Our Advertising and Email modules will finish the core five-product suite and are scheduled to be completed by summer of 2015."
